What is 83/60 Divided By 8/4

Answer: 8360÷84\frac{83}{60}\div\frac{8}{4} = 83120\frac{83}{120}

Solving 8360÷84\frac{83}{60}\div\frac{8}{4}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

8360÷84=8360×48\frac{83}{60} \div \frac{8}{4} = \frac{83}{60} \times \frac{4}{8}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 83×4=33283 \times 4 = 332
  • Multiply the Denominators: 60×8=48060 \times 8 = 480
  • Form the New Fraction: 8360×84=332480\frac{83}{60} \times \frac{8}{4} = \frac{332}{480}

Let's Simplify 332480\frac{332}{480}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 332332 and 480480. The GCD of 332332 and 480480 is 44.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:332÷4480÷4=83120\frac{332 \div 4}{480 \div 4} = \frac{83}{120}

Answer 8360÷84=83120\frac{83}{60}\div\frac{8}{4} = \frac{83}{120}
